Muir wants new health card for diabetics

Crossbench senator Ricky Muir has introduced a private bill to create a special healthcare card for people with Type 1 diabetes.

Motoring Enthusiast Ricky Muir wants Type 1 diabetes sufferers to receive a special healthcare card ensuring access to medication and treatment for the illness.

The card would be available for any sufferer or those with dependent children suffering the disease, provided their income does not exceed $88,000, or $176,000 for couples.

The private bill, introduced to the Senate on Thursday, would provide benefits additional to those already made available by the federal government for diabetes sufferers.
